danielsumner Posted March 14, 2014 #4 Share Posted March 14, 2014 We take the trams straight toward the shopping area, it comes to a stop and turns around at a tram stop. Directly to the right is where we like to go. You have a direct view of the folks coming down the zip lines and you can see the ship way over to your left. Never have reserved a clam shell, but always get one. I just give on of the guys 10 bucks and they set one up were we want it. You are right at a bar and the food. Take water shoes, you will regret it if you don't.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
dawnmariex Posted March 15, 2014 #5 Share Posted March 15, 2014 We paid for the excursion to Malfini Beach. A boat takes you to it. It was so quiet and relaxing! We were there with only 3 other couples. Had our choice of places to sit, free rafts to float on and a free drink. Only complaint is you can't stay all day. You can only sign up for 1/2 a day. Worth every penny! On another trip we went to Columbus Cove. The water was very mild , but it was super crowded. You can swim there and some of the other beaches are not suitable for swimming. If that is important to you, check out which beaches allow swimming. Hope you have fun!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
